For Combined Anabolic Therapy (CAT) Phase 4 trial, fulll dose of romosoumab (210mg) and teriparatide (20mcg) will be used. Study duration: 12mo. 2 study groups: romosoumab vs romosozumab + teriparatide. Outcome measure will be L-spine Lumbar areal bone mineral density 12mo vs 0mo.

For oral teriparatide tablet (EB613), the chosen dosage hasn't been disclosed. Duration of the study will be 12mo, with "an open-label extension study to follow patients through 24 months to supplement EB613’s safety, durability of effect and sequence data"; and "primary endpoint of total hip bone mineral density (BMD) at Month 12".
